    Current Squad Analysis: Strengths and Weaknesses

    Before we dive into the transfer rumors, let's take a look at the current Manchester United squad. Understanding the team's strengths and weaknesses is crucial to figuring out what kind of players they need to bring in. As of now, there are some glaring gaps that need addressing if United wants to compete for major titles.

    • Strengths: United definitely has some star power in the attacking department. With players like Marcus Rashford, Bruno Fernandes, and potentially a revitalized Jadon Sancho, they have the potential to score goals. The midfield, anchored by Casemiro, provides some much-needed steel and experience.
    • Weaknesses: Defense has been a major concern for United. Injuries and inconsistent performances have plagued the backline. A reliable center-back partnership is a must. The striker position is another area of concern. While they have talented players, a consistent goal-scorer is needed to lead the line. Depth in midfield and on the wings could also be improved.

    • Harry Kane (Striker): The Tottenham Hotspur star has been linked with United for years, and the rumors are swirling again. Kane is one of the best strikers in the world, and his goal-scoring record speaks for itself. He's exactly the kind of player United needs to lead the line. However, signing Kane won't be easy. Spurs are notoriously tough negotiators, and other top clubs will also be in the mix. Plus, Kane won't come cheap – we're talking about a massive transfer fee and wages. It's a long shot, but if United could pull it off, it would be a statement signing.
    • Victor Osimhen (Striker): Another top striker on United's radar is Napoli's Victor Osimhen. The Nigerian international had a fantastic season, helping Napoli win the Serie A title. Osimhen is a powerful, pacey striker with a knack for scoring goals. He's also younger than Kane, which could make him a more appealing long-term option. Like Kane, Osimhen won't be cheap, and Napoli will be looking for a hefty fee. But his potential is huge, and he could be a game-changer for United. His physical presence and ability to run in behind defenses would add a new dimension to United’s attack.
    • Kim Min-jae (Center-Back): The South Korean defender has been a rock at the back for Napoli and is attracting interest from several top clubs, including Manchester United. Kim is a commanding presence in the air, a strong tackler, and excellent on the ball. He would be a perfect fit for United's defense and could form a formidable partnership with Varane. The competition for his signature will be fierce, but United needs to make a strong push to land him. Kim’s ability to read the game and his composure under pressure are exactly what United’s defense needs.
    • Frenkie de Jong (Central Midfielder): The Barcelona midfielder has been a long-term target for United, and the rumors persist. De Jong is a technically gifted midfielder with excellent vision and passing ability. He would bring creativity and control to United's midfield. However, De Jong has stated his desire to stay at Barcelona, which could make a move difficult. But if United can convince him to join, he would be a fantastic addition. His ability to dictate the tempo of the game and his versatility in midfield would make him a key player for United.

    Confirmed Deals and Departures

    • Potential Departures: There are always players who might be on their way out of the club. Some players might be looking for more playing time, while others might simply not fit into the manager's plans. Here are a few players who have been linked with a move away from Old Trafford:
      • Harry Maguire: The England international has faced criticism for his performances and could be looking for a fresh start. Several clubs have been linked with a move for him.
      • Anthony Martial: Injuries have hampered Martial’s time at United, and he might be seeking a move to get his career back on track.
      • Donny van de Beek: The Dutch midfielder has struggled for playing time and could be looking for a loan or permanent move to get more minutes on the pitch.
